Dan go makes a good point, that being fit in your 20's isn't quite as hard, but in your 40's and beyond it becomes a status symbol, because you can only be fit with lots of deliberate action.

Image Description

A tweet by Dan Go (@FitFounder) highlighting that being fit in your 20s isn't impressive due to favorable conditions like time and hormones, but being fit at 40+ is a status symbol, showing the ability to prioritize fitness amidst life's responsibilities.

Positive Aspects

The tweet effectively captures the essence of the blog post, emphasizing the societal value and personal achievement of staying fit in your 40s. It resonates with readers who understand the challenges of balancing health with other commitments.

Key Takeaways

  • Being fit in your 20s is relatively easier due to ample time, energy, and hormonal advantages.
  • Achieving and maintaining fitness in your 40s is a status symbol, reflecting deliberate effort and discipline.
  • Fitness at an older age demonstrates the ability to manage various life responsibilities while prioritizing personal health.

Additional Insights

Staying fit in your 40s often requires strategic planning and lifestyle adjustments. Consider integrating workouts into daily routines, such as morning runs or lunchtime gym sessions, to maintain consistency. Also, embracing community activities or fitness groups can offer motivation and accountability.
